Released in 1993, Rigoletto is a drame film directed by Leo D. Paur, running about 98 minutes. “A Musical Fantasy Ringing of Truth & Filled With Mystery & Love” — that tagline sets the tone.

What it’s about. Things are not going well in the depression-era town of Castle Gate. Mr. Ribaldi, a mysterious rich man with a disfigured face and an abrasive personality, has just bought and moved into a long-vacant mansion. Bonnie, an adolescent girl who loves to sing, ends up working for Ribaldi so that her family can stay in their house. But Ribaldi is quite an accomplished musician himself, and he is soon giving Bonnie voice lessons. Meanwhile, local businesses are being shut down by foreclosures, and the townspeople suspect Ribaldi is responsible.

Who’s in it. Rigoletto stars Joseph Paur, Ivey Lloyd, Cynthia Jump and John Huntington.
